Description
This gene encodes a class I seven-transmembrane G-protein-coupled receptor. The encoded protein is a receptor for angiotensin-(1-7) and preferentially couples to the Gq protein, activating the phospholipase C signaling pathway. The encoded protein may play a role in multiple processes including hypotension, smooth muscle relaxation and cardioprotection by mediating the effects of angiotensin-(1-7).

Background
MAS1 is a gene that encodes a G protein-coupled receptor (GPCR) involved in various physiological processes, including cardiovascular regulation, neuronal signaling, and cellular proliferation. It was originally identified as a proto-oncogene due to its potential role in tumorigenesis. MAS1 is involved in signaling pathways that regulate the growth and differentiation of cells. It is also known for its interaction with the angiotensin peptide, particularly in the regulation of blood pressure and fluid balance. MAS1 functions in mediating the effects of angiotensin peptides on vascular smooth muscle and endothelial cells, contributing to vasodilation and regulating blood pressure. Studies suggest that MAS1 may play a protective role in cardiovascular health by modulating angiotensin-induced vasoconstriction. Dysregulation of MAS1 signaling has been implicated in various cancers and cardiovascular diseases, and research into its role as a tumor suppressor or oncogene could provide novel insights for therapeutic strategies.
